Meet the artist: Kastehelmi Korpijaakko
The artist Kastehelmi Korpijaakko will be at Valokuvagalleria Hippolyte to meet visitors and discuss the exhibition A Comedy About a Meadow That Wanted to Own Itself.
Kastehelmi Korpijaakko (b. 1984, Lohja) is a photographic artist based in Helsinki, working on Harakka Island. She graduated with a Master of Arts from the Photography programme at Aalto University in 2018. Her work has been shown in solo exhibitions, including Huuto Gallery (2023) and Taidekeskus Mältinranta (2021), as well as in the group exhibition the Mänttä Art Festival in summer 2025. The body of work shown at Hippolyte continues in the Poriginal Gallery at Pori Art Museum in September 2025.
